Total Assets

The aggregate of all financial resources owned by a company, including current and non-current assets, which reflects its total economic value.

Statement Of Income

A financial document showing a company's revenue, expenses, and profits over a specific period, also known as an income statement.

Retained Earnings

The portion of net income left over for a company after it has paid out dividends to its shareholders.

Specific Period

A specific period in accounting refers to a set time frame for which financial statements are prepared or to which particular financial transactions or events pertain.
